£300,000 for Ballymacash Sports Academy
Ballymacash Sports Academy has been awarded £300,000 from the Community Ownership Fund to provide sport facilities for local people.

Rushmore Drive Improvements
»Ê¹ÚÌåÓýapp improvements include:
- mini allotments and a community garden
- a new full size floodlit 3g pitch
- 100-seater spectator stand
- outdoor gym equipment
- perimeter fencing
Benefits to the local community
Improvements to the Academy will benefit the local community by:
- providing better links between the academy, schools and the community
- increasing participation in sport for all genders, ages and abilities
- offering affordable skills sessions
- creating new job opportunities
Funding will ensure that the academy responds to the community’s needs and provide a modern sports facility for the local area.
